Several current research efforts directed at cognition in learning environments suggest there are at least three separate factors at play in learner engagement:
- Emotional Engagement – How the learner feels about the learning experience.
- Intellectual Engagement – What the learner thinks about the information presented in the learning experience.
- Environmental Engagement – How the learner’s interaction with the learning environment change both the environment and learner’s perception of the experience.
